I think it would be absolutely grand if someone could make a simple app that started with a 4 set counter (1/4, 2/4, 3/4, 4/4). Every time a set was counted a 45 second interval would start for a rest period. After four sets were completed, a 2 minute interval would start followed by a restart of the set counter to 1/4.

    I tried doing this with the built in interval timer, but the 2 minute break between exercises was a problem. Since i didn't know exactly when i finished, i couldn't time that 2 minute rest between different weight training exercises. The option for user specified counts and timeouts would be great. If you could help, that would be fantastic. What i'm looking for is this

    4 Set counter(hit lap to acknowledge set completion)
    45 second timer between sets

    2 minute timer after 4 sets have been completed

    repeat as you move on to each exercise

  • I'm assuming the problem is that you created the workout on the watch. It only allows creation of very simple interval workouts. You can build more complex ones from this page, and then upload them to your device.
